body{
	margin:0px;
	padding:0px;
	background:#fce89f;
	font-family:tahoma;
	font-size:11px;
	color:#333333;
	}
	
a{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#b52105;
	text-decoration:underline;
	}
	
a:hover{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#b52105;
	text-decoration:none;
	}
	
form{
	padding:0px;
	margin:0px;
	}
	
.header_bg{
	background:url(https://www.shackelfords.com/media/images/header_bg.gif);
	background-position:left top;
	background-repeat:repeat-x;
	height:271px;
	}
	
.body_bg{
	background:url(https://www.shackelfords.com/media/images/body_bg.jpg);
	background-position:left top;
	background-repeat:repeat-x;
	height:116px;
	}
	
.body_back{
	background:#fce89f url(https://www.shackelfords.com/media/images/body_back.jpg);
	background-position:left top;
	background-repeat:repeat-x;
	height:288px;
	}
	
.orange_box{
	background: url(https://www.shackelfords.com/media/images/orange_box.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	width:220px;
	height:282px;
	}
	
.link1{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#b52105;
	text-decoration:underline;
	}
	
a.link1:hover{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#530904;
	text-decoration:underline;
	}
	
.orange_box_bg{
	background:url(https://www.shackelfords.com/media/images/orange_box_bg.jpg);
	background-position:left top;
	background-repeat:repeat-y;
	width:220px;
	}
	
.green_box_bg{
	background:url(https://www.shackelfords.com/media/images/green_box_bg.jpg);
	background-position:left top;
	background-repeat:repeat-y;
	width:221px;
	}
	
.green_box{
	background: url(https://www.shackelfords.com/media/images/green_box.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	width:221px;
	height:149px;
	}
	
.yellow_text{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#f4df2d;
	}
	
.link2{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#005f14;
	text-decoration:underline;
	}
	
a.link2:hover{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#5e8404;
	text-decoration:underline;
	}
	
.pink_box{
	background:#faa1ac url(https://www.shackelfords.com/media/images/pink_box.jpg);
	background-position:left bottom;
	background-repeat:no-repeat;
	height:185px;
	width:219px;
	}
	
.red_text{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#a21d25;
	}
	
.link3{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#ffffff;
	text-decoration:underline;
	}
	
a.link3:hover{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#b61529;
	text-decoration:underline;
	}
	
.link4{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#000000;
	text-decoration:underline;
	}
	
a.link4:hover{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#000000;
	text-decoration:none;
	}
	
.red_box{
	background:url(https://www.shackelfords.com/media/images/red_box.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	height:94px;
	width:220px;
	}
	
.orange_text{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#f6a054;
	}
	
.text1{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#000000;
	}
	
.red_text1{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#cd0239;
	}
	
.boxborder{
	border:1px solid #a29566;
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#a29566;
	}
	
.go_btn{
	background:url(https://www.shackelfords.com/media/images/go_btn.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	height:17px;
	width:25px;
	border:0px;
	cursor:pointer;
	}
	
.body_text{
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:normal;
	color:#522c0d;
	}
	
.big_red_text{
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#a22028;
	}
	
.big_green_text{
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#6e9b08;
	}	
	
.small_text{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	font-weight:normal;
	color:#716651;
	}
	
.heading1{
	font-family:tahoma;
	font-size:12px;
	font-weight:bold;
	color:#be0c0c;
	}
	
.heading2{
	font-family:tahoma;
	font-size:12px;
	font-weight:bold;
	color:#000000;
	}
	
.white_box_bg{
	background:url(https://www.shackelfords.com/media/images/white_box_bg.gif);
	background-position:left top;
	background-repeat:repeat-y;
	width:176px;
	}
	
.white_box_bottom{
	background:url(https://www.shackelfords.com/media/images/white_box_bottom.gif);
	background-position:left top;
	background-repeat:no-repeat;
	width:176px;
	height:10px;
	}
	
.footer_box1_bg{
	/*background:url(https://www.shackelfords.com/media/images/footer_box1_bg.gif);
	background-position:left top;
	background-repeat:repeat-x;*/
	height:41px;
	}
	
.footer_box2_bg{
	background:url(https://www.shackelfords.com/media/images/footer_box2_bg.gif);
	background-position:left top;
	background-repeat:repeat-x;
	height:79px;
	}
	
.footer_menu{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:normal;
	color:#522c0d;
	text-decoration:none;
	}
	
a.footer_menu:hover{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:normal;
	color:#522c0d;
	text-decoration:underline;
	}
	
.footer_text{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#b9a04e;
	}
	
.footer_link{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#b9a04e;
	text-decoration:underline;
	}
	
a.footer_link:hover{
	font-family:tahoma;
	font-size:11px;
	font-weight:normal;
	color:#b9a04e;
	text-decoration:none;
	}
	
.header_image{
	background:url(https://www.shackelfords.com/media/images/header_image.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	height:271px;
	width:829px;
	}
	
.blue_text{
	font-family:tahoma;
	font-size:11px;
	font-weight:bold;
	color:#0b3f5c;
	}
	
.heading_bg{
	background:url(https://www.shackelfords.com/media/images/heading_bg.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	height:64px;
	font-family:tahoma;
	font-size:14px;
	font-weight:bold;
	color:#b52105;
	padding:0px 0px 0px 50px;
	}
	
.yellow_bg{
	background:#ff9702 url(https://www.shackelfords.com/media/images/yellow_bg.gif);
	background-position:left top;
	background-repeat:repeat-x;
	border:1px solid #e76304;
	}
	
	

